Leagues or Teams will sometimes have contracts that all visible gear has to be CCM, or Whomever.  If someone needs to wear a non CCM branded item, they'll either (if the contract allows this) Just blank out the logo, or sticker it like they do here.  Sometimes on gloves they'll replace the cuff with the proper brand to satisfy the contract.

The captain gets a special patch above the crest on the sleeve, it's not an arm band. The NHL rules require a C and A on the front of the sweater -- if FLA wants to remove it, they'll need a league-approved variance.

The logo is inspired by the logo of the 101st Airborne Division of the United States Army which their owner was a member of in the 70's.
